#16ffb5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#16ffb5 is composed of 8.6% red, 100%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 29%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 160.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 54.3%. #16ffb5 color hex could be obtained by blending #2cffff with #00ff6b. Closest websafe color is: #00ffcc.

#16ffb5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#16ffb5 has RGB values of R:22, G:255,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0. Its decimal value is 1507253.

Shades and Tints of #16ffb5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000202 is the darkest color, while #eefffa is the lightest one.
